Guest Posted September 9, 2014 Share Posted September 9, 2014 Hi Prema,Thanks for the excellent work you do with BIOSs. I used your BIOS mod to flash my P157SM-A and its been great. My only question is I set both the User and the HDD Passwords and now have to enter my SSD's password upon boot. I have also noticed that when I go back into the BIOS itself the HDD Password is not showing as being enabled and active. Can you confirm whether or not the HDD password is running and am I supposed to "login" to my 840 Evo every time upon boot? Yeah, the BIOS menu doesn't refresh the SSD/HDD password status unless user pass is set or deleted first. User pass is only asked upon entering BIOS menu. SSD/HDD pass is asked on each boot.
